Type
ORACLE
Validation date
2024-04-02 21:05: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03416,
    "usd": 0.03679
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00011715093B28256AA6DD33391CE78C6C19A778F54BCFF128CCC8B94BE6B2F8CFA4

Previous signature

E670ECF49D4F71CB891B6E1DD8812D9B92CAEB46501AC88F79B4F230592189A498A3979BACA2309DA5C75969BF2ADD92B7AADE697868460CC4D46DA308DE3205

Origin signature

3045022074D47F918BD3B0B761160ECE78EF1B1357BA94E67D7326522A95117FE53B1159022100D65FCE3A20E6DBFEC93A27BC2834BAE35E864C695BAB0C70EF0870E40262504F

Proof of work

010104EB90F7BDD03D5A7FD9B61D9128D7CF24C11F3F7DA96825DA3680C2B6BCC48F1AFCE26E0A5F1A903EDAA4BC9390210A0A4F175847EC2A2BB325BB6D1CE8EC8F90

Proof of integrity

00E36A1C18395296DCAC0F59A82B53FB28751084E2C17F589D36A14F25E4E96882

Coordinator signature

242D6AD75722390EE637CDB5E811BD3E64E9D7ECA070028876DE6A047A5C03F456D72ADE1F4FE5189F2591F0E27A44A7FA6E072E07A6D8F3662DCDD4A3DA1C07

Validator #1 public key

000177BA744AC778DC2D51A1B7C622E7AC4BD1E1AA8DA2D0FCE71BAAB7DAD0E020E0

Validator #1 signature

5A9DBD3C6317B62CFEAEED099A8F1C5F4906C62596C6E4A63270079F1432A0BE4057CE7D7B12EC060C9B2F44534BF096B0371DF27C3BE8A15A384C647B446B06

Validator #2 public key

0001B0A94804BF8ECC9897075C6207FF63EF4D339F57A0349888E6B77CD47DB53EF3

Validator #2 signature

2AF85CFCC3B4D858DD2DD80D01CB0673AAB4EB6EA56EA124F74973F6068485815D88F0AAE3DA59A866D8DE091045DD61671FD61D9819A6BEC10D15B96BCE4C05